Abstract

The utility model discloses a novel LED (light emitting diode) bulb lamp, comprising an aluminum alloy heat sink, an LED lamp plate, a lampshade, an LED driving power supply, fish paper, a lamp holder, a copper lamp cap, a lamp cap screw, a lampshade end cover and a plurality of stainless steel screws, wherein the aluminum alloy heat sink comprises a heat radiation main body and a heat-radiating plate, is of a sunflower structure and is internally hollow; and the LED lamp plate comprises an aluminum base plate and a plurality of LED bulbs, and the LED lamp plate and the aluminum alloy heat sink are locked by a screw; the lampshade is milky-white frosted glass, and the lampshade end cover is made from casting aluminum and is adhered to the lampshade. The lamp holder is made of milky-white plastic, a combined part of the LED driving power supply and the aluminum alloy heat sink is provided with the fish paper; and the copper lamp cap is a copper screw socket, and a copper cap screw is a fixed positive electrode of an input line of the LED driving power supply. The novel LED bulb lamp disclosed by the utility model has the advantages of low energy consumption, long service life, high luminous efficiency, high color rendering index, environment-friendliness and the like, and effectively solves a short-circuit situation generated by the contact of the power supply and the heat sink.
